From the news: - By The Canadian Press Tuesday, October 5, 2010 ORILLIA, Ont. - Provincial police say a Mississauga, Ont., doctor is facing a charge of fraudulently billing to the Ontario Health Insurance Plan. Police say OHIP alleged a doctor had submitted billings for fees for services which were not rendered. The complaint was investigated by the provincial police anti-rackets health fraud investigation unit. Dariusz Piatek is charged with one count of fraud over $5,000. Piatek, 47, is scheduled to appear in court on Nov. 8 in Brampton, Ont. - MISSISSAUGA, ONTARIO-(CCNMatthews - May 17, 2005) A Mississauga man was fined $75,702 after being found guilty on eight counts of tax evasion in Ontario Court of Justice on May 16, 2005. Dr. Dariusz Piatek, owner of a general practice medical clinic called Medicina Dextra, failed to declare $465,274 on his 1997 and 1998 individual income tax returns. The fine represents 50% of the federal income tax that he tried to evade. Dr. Piatek claimed to have filed his 1997 and 1998 income tax returns and to have paid outstanding tax arrears owed for taxation year 1996 and 1999. However, a Canada Revenue Agency (CRA) investigation revealed that letters produced by Dr. Piatek, which had allegedly been sent to him by the CRA confirming receipt of payment and acknowledging tax returns filed, were fictitious.
